Description
This procurement relates to a single package of work for High Voltage (HV) Power Systems for Phase 1 and Phase 2a of the Project. The scope of work for the design, build, testing and commissioning includes without limitation the specification, design, procurement, supply of materials, procurement of Distribution Network Operators (DNO) connections, installation, factory and site testing, commissioning, training, spares provision, any caretaking or maintenance requirements prior to completion, consents, interfacing with HS2 Ltd.'s other contractors and stakeholders, interface with National Grid, and provision of all required hand-over documentation of a fully commissioned HV Power System.
The scope of work for maintenance includes some or all of the ongoing maintenance of the completed works.
Please note that HS2 Ltd reserves the right in its absolute discretion to omit any work, including work related to Phase 2a and further details of this right will appear in the ITT documentation issued to Tenderers in due course.
